My Mum is a beautifully illustrated, stereotype-busting celebration of all the everyday things one child's disabled mum does to make her so wonderfully awesome!
My Mum says that when I arrived
I was like a star
drifting
down
from the sky
and into her life.
The story follows mother and child from before the child is born, celebrating the bond between mother and child even when the child is just a dream. With a wonderful inclusive feel, all mother and child relationships are celebrated in this story – whether biological or adoptive mothers.
A joyous spirit of adventure is present throughout the story, following mother and child as they take on life's big and small adventures – together. From sailing a ship around the garden and exploring forests, streams and meadows to telling stories in a cosy den and cuddling before bedtime, a child reveals all the simple yet amazing things she loves to do with her wondrously adventurous mum.
With lyrical text by Susan Quinn and imagination-filled illustrations from Sarah Mathew, My Mum is a joyous celebration of motherhood, perfect for enjoying together as mum and child – creating a special reading experience for children to treasure.

Sarah Mathew is a freelance illustrator who lives in Cambridge with her husband and three boys. Sarah is naturally curious and loves collecting little seeds of inspiration. Sarah takes a playful and experimental approach to her work, testing out new ways of working and seeing where the happy accidents or beginnings of ideas go. Sarah has many treasured memories of being snuggled up with her children reading a big pile of picture books.
